Open the largest m2ts file which is located in BDMV\STREAM folder.
This works for most Blu Ray discs I've come across, but not for one. I've ripped all of my BD movies to ISO using SlySoft's AnyDVD HD software, and the disc
Inception has many *.m2ts files in BDMV/STREAM, none of which are feature length (the film seems to be distributed across all/most of the files in this directory).
It'd be nice if VLC could play .mpls playlist files, so films like this can be played in their entirety. Note I'm using VLC on Linux, and it can read most Blu Ray I've come across (but no menus yet).
EDIT: I read elsewhere on this forum that the BDMV folder can be opened directly by VLC, and it plays the feature properly (thus far, still watching/testing). After further watching, it plays everything in the directory, including film documentary ("making of...") stuff I don't want to see when I'm watching the movie.
